Teenager seriously injured in car crash

POLICE are appealing for witnesses after a teenager was seriously injured when she lost control of her car in Thurcroft on Tuesday evening.

The 19-year-old Bramley woman was driving a grey Vauxhall Tigra from Laughton Common towards Thurcroft on Green Arbour Road.

After going round a right-hand bend, the car left the road 20 metres north of the junction with Hawk Hill Lane.

The Tigra spun 180 degrees before rolling down a shallow bank into a field where it turned back over onto its wheels at around 7.10pm.

The driver sustained serious injuries and was taken to Rotherham District General Hospital.

Her passenger, an 18-year-old Sunnyside woman, sustained slight injuries including whiplash and neck pains. She was taken to hospital but later released.
